Our Beautiful Soup Scraper is designed to transform complex web pages into clean, structured datasets that support accurate analysis and faster decision-making. Built on robust parsing logic, it efficiently extracts product details, pricing information, and availability data from diverse online sources. With seamless Beautiful Soup Scraping API Integration, businesses can automate data collection workflows, connect outputs directly to analytics systems, and maintain a consistent flow of reliable information.
Built on open source libraries, it ensures transparency, customization freedom, cost efficiency, and adaptability for evolving data extraction requirements.
Transform raw web content into organized datasets using HTML Parsing With Beautiful Soup, enabling faster analysis and consistent decision-making accuracy.
Extract product details, pricing, and availability seamlessly through Beautiful Soup Data Extraction, ensuring structured outputs for analytics and reporting workflows.
Track product categories, demand shifts, and assortment trends to support better planning, merchandising decisions, and improved product performance strategies.
Enable automated workflows and seamless data delivery across systems using Advanced Beautiful Soup Web Scraping Techniques for continuous and reliable processing.
Track stock availability, identify supply gaps, and maintain optimal inventory levels to reduce missed sales opportunities and improve operational performance.
import requests
from bs4 import BeautifulSoup
HEADERS = {
"User-Agent": "Mozilla/5.0 (X11; Linux x86_64)",
"Accept-Language": "en-US,en;q=0.8"
}
def fetch_product_details(page_url):
try:
response = requests.get(page_url, headers=HEADERS, timeout=10)
response.raise_for_status()
except requests.exceptions.RequestException:
return {"error": "Failed to retrieve page"}
soup = BeautifulSoup(response.content, "html.parser")
def extract_text(tag, class_name):
element = soup.find(tag, class_=class_name)
return element.get_text(strip=True) if element else "Not Available"
product_info = {
"Product Name": extract_text("h1", "item-title"),
"Current Price": extract_text("span", "price-value"),
"User Rating": extract_text("div", "rating-score"),
"Availability": extract_text("p", "stock-status")
}
return product_info
# Example product page URL
sample_url = "https://www.example.com/item/sample-product"
result = fetch_product_details(sample_url)
print(result)
Leverage flexible frameworks powered by Python Beautiful Soup Scraper, enabling customization, scalability, & cost-efficient data extraction across diverse environments.
Track dynamic pricing patterns and competitor movements using Beautiful Soup Data Extraction, enabling accurate comparisons and smarter pricing strategies.
Analyze product listings and trends efficiently through HTML Parsing With Beautiful Soup, identifying demand shifts and improving assortment planning decisions.
Automate extraction pipelines using Advanced Beautiful Soup Web Scraping Techniques to ensure consistent data delivery and streamlined analytics workflows.
Initiate workflows using Advanced Beautiful Soup Web Scraping Techniques, enabling efficient extraction, scalability, and flexibility across diverse web platforms.
Capture structured datasets through Beautiful Soup Data Extraction, ensuring accurate retrieval of product details, pricing information, and relevant metadata.
Process raw HTML content efficiently using HTML Parsing With Beautiful Soup, converting unstructured data into organized formats for analytics systems.
Deliver extracted datasets seamlessly using Beautiful Soup Web Scraping API, ensuring automated integration, real-time accessibility, and consistent data flow across platforms.
When using Beautiful Soup Scraper, ensure adherence to website terms, data privacy laws, and ethical scraping practices to maintain legal compliance and integrity.
Contact UsEffortlessly managing intricacies with customized strategies.
Mitigating risks, navigating regulations, and cultivating trust.
Leveraging expertise from our internationally acclaimed team of developers
Reliable guidance and assistance for your business's advancement